What is a Normal Skin Type?
A normal skin type is characterized by balanced hydration levels, minimal sensitivity, and even texture. Unlike oily or dry skin, normal skin produces just the right amount of sebum, making it less prone to acne, flakiness, or excessive shine.
- Key Features of Normal Skin:
Well-balanced oil and moisture levels
Smooth, even texture
Small, barely visible pores
Few breakouts or blemishes
No extreme sensitivity

How to Identify If You Have Normal Skin
If you’re unsure about your skin type, try this simple test:
- Wash your face with a mild cleanser and pat it dry.
Wait for 30 minutes without applying any products.
Observe your skin: - If it feels balanced (not tight, dry, or oily), you have normal skin.
- If it becomes shiny, you might have oily skin.
- If it feels tight or flaky, you likely have dry skin.

Best Ingredients for Normal Skin
To maintain healthy skin, look for these beneficial ingredients in your skincare products:
- Hyaluronic Acid – Keeps skin plump and hydrated.
Vitamin C – Brightens skin and protects against free radicals.
Niacinamide – Controls oil production and strengthens the skin barrier.
Aloe Vera – Soothes and calms irritation.
Peptides – Boost collagen production for anti-aging benefits.
Stick to products with gentle, non-irritating formulas to keep your skin naturally balanced.

Common Myths About Normal Skin
- Myth 1: Normal skin doesn’t need skincare.
Truth: Even normal skin needs proper cleansing, hydration, and sun protection to stay healthy. - Myth 2: You don’t need to moisturize if your skin isn’t dry.
Truth: Moisturizers help maintain your skin’s protective barrier, preventing dehydration. - Myth 3: Sunscreen is unnecessary if you don’t burn easily.
Truth: UV rays cause premature aging, even if you don’t see visible sunburns.

FAQs
1. Can normal skin become oily or dry over time?
Yes! Factors like age, climate, stress, and diet can shift your skin type. Keeping a balanced skincare routine helps maintain normal skin.
2. How often should I wash my face if I have normal skin?
Twice a day—morning and night—is ideal to keep your skin fresh and free of dirt or oil buildup.
3. What foods help maintain normal skin?
- A diet rich in antioxidants, omega-3 fatty acids, and hydration supports healthy skin. Eat plenty of:
Fruits and vegetables (for vitamins and minerals)
Nuts and seeds (for healthy fats)
Water (to keep skin hydrated)
4. Can normal skin develop acne?
Yes! While less prone to breakouts, normal skin can still develop hormonal acne or occasional blemishes due to diet, stress, or improper skincare.
5. Do I need anti-aging products if I have normal skin?
It’s never too early to start! Using antioxidants (Vitamin C), SPF, and collagen-boosting ingredients can prevent premature aging.
